> I've been very successful with a studio setup using 2 T-32's on one
> umbrella, another T-32 into a reflector as a fill, and a T-20 as a
> background light, all controlled by an OM-4ti and the necessary cords.
> 
> It will all work, you just need the right connections.  I wish I could dial
> down the T-32's at will, but without that capability I just alter their
> light output via filtration or I use a T-20.

> I should caveat this by stating in Normal Auto the flash units need to be
> at the camera location (on a flash bracket, BG-2, in hot shoe, etc.) and
> cannot be remoted in a different location or allowed to illuminate any of
> the other flash head sensors.  It's easier to use TTL-Auto if possible.
